Source database limitations

  • Tables to be migrated must have a PRIMARY KEY or a UNIQUE constraint, and the fields in the key or constraint must be unique. Otherwise, this may cause duplicate data in the destination database.

  • Enterprise Edition PolarDB-X 2.0 read-only instances are not supported as a source database.

  • If you migrate objects at the table level and need to edit them, for example, by mapping column names, a single data migration task supports a maximum of 1,000 tables. If you exceed this limit, the task submission will fail. In this case, split the tables into multiple data migration tasks or configure a task to migrate the entire database.

  • For incremental data migration, the source database must meet the following binary log requirements:

    • Enable the binary log feature, and set the binlog_row_image parameter to full. Otherwise, the precheck fails and the data migration task cannot start.

    • For incremental data migration tasks, DTS requires that the binary logs of the source database be retained for at least 24 hours. For tasks that include both full data migration and incremental data migration, the binary logs must be retained for at least 7 days. You can change the retention period to 24 hours after the full data migration is complete. If the binary logs are not retained for the required period, DTS may fail to obtain them, which can cause task failures or even data inconsistency and loss. The DTS SLA does not cover issues caused by an insufficient binary log retention period.

  • Operational limitations on the source database:

    • During schema migration and full data migration, do not perform DDL operations that change the database or table schema. Otherwise, the data migration task will fail.

      Note

      During full data migration, DTS queries the source database. This action places a metadata lock, which may block DDL operations on the source database.

    • During full and incremental migration, DTS temporarily disables constraint checks and foreign key cascading operations at the session level. If cascading update or delete operations occur in the source database while the task is running, data inconsistencies may occur.

    • If you need to change the network type of the PolarDB-X 2.0 instance during migration, you must update the network connection information of the migration task after the change is complete.

    • If you perform only full data migration, do not write new data to the source database during the migration. Otherwise, data will become inconsistent between the source and destination databases. To maintain real-time data consistency, select schema migration, full data migration, and incremental data migration.

  • Migration of table groups (TABLEGROUP) and databases or tables with the Locality attribute is not supported.

  • Migration of tables whose names are reserved words, such as select, is not supported.

  • In a PolarDB-X 2.0 instance, database partitions in DRDS mode are not supported for synchronization.

  • During the operation of a DTS migration task, changing the type of a broadcast table in the source PolarDB-X 2.0 instance (for example, changing a broadcast table to a regular table or a sharded table) is not supported. To change the table type, stop the migration task first, and then reconfigure the migration task after the change is complete.

Other limitations

  • Only table-level migration is supported. AO tables are not supported as destination tables.

  • Data is lost from source columns that do not exist in the destination table. This occurs if you use column mapping or if the table schemas do not match.

  • If a table to be migrated has a primary key, the primary key column in the destination table must be the same as that in the source table. If a table to be migrated does not have a primary key, the primary key column in the destination table must be the same as the distribution key.

  • The unique key of the destination table, including the primary key column, must contain all columns of the distribution key.

  • Before starting the data migration, evaluate the performance of your source and destination databases. We recommend migrating data during off-peak hours. A full data migration consumes read and write resources on both databases, which increases their load.

  • DTS attempts to restore failed migration tasks within seven days. Therefore, before you switch your business to the target instance, you must end or release the task, or use the revoke command to revoke the write permissions of the account that DTS uses to access the target instance. This prevents the source data from overwriting the data on the target instance after the task is automatically restored.

  • If a task fails, DTS support staff will attempt to restore it within eight hours. During restoration, they may restart the task or adjust its parameters.

    Note

    Only DTS task parameters are modified—not database parameters. Parameters that may be adjusted include those listed in Modify instance parameters.

Other precautions

DTS periodically updates the dts_health_check.ha_health_check table in the source database to advance the binlog position.

Migration types

  • Schema migration

    DTS migrates the schema definitions of the migration objects from the source database to the destination database.

  • Full migration

    DTS migrates all historical data of the specified migration objects from the source database to the destination database.

  • Incremental migration

    After a full migration is complete, DTS migrates incremental data updates from the source database to the destination database. Incremental migration lets you smoothly migrate data without interrupting your self-managed applications.

Supported SQL operations for incremental migration

Operation type

SQL statement

DML

INSERT, UPDATE, and DELETE

Note

When data is written to a destination AnalyticDB for PostgreSQL instance, the system automatically converts UPDATE statements to REPLACE INTO statements. If an UPDATE statement modifies a primary key, the system converts it to a DELETE statement followed by an INSERT statement instead.

DDL

ADD COLUMN

      Processing Mode for Existing Destination Tables

      • Precheck and Report Errors: Checks whether tables with the same names exist in the destination database. If no tables with the same names exist, the precheck is passed. If tables with the same names exist, an error is reported during the precheck, and the data migration task does not start.

        Note

        If a table in the destination database has the same name but cannot be easily deleted or renamed, you can change the name of the table in the destination database. For more information, see Object name mapping.

      • Ignore Errors and Proceed: Skips the check for tables with the same names.

        Warning

        Selecting Ignore Errors and Proceed may cause data inconsistency and business risks. For example:

        • If the table schemas are consistent and a record in the destination database has the same primary key value as a record in the source database:

          • During full migration, DTS keeps the record in the destination database. The record from the source database is not migrated.

          • During incremental migration, DTS does not keep the record in the destination database. The record from the source database overwrites the record in the destination database.

        • If the table schemas are inconsistent, only some columns of data may be migrated, or the migration may fail. Proceed with caution.

      Retry Time for Failed Connections

      After the migration task starts, if the connection to the source or destination database fails, DTS reports an error and immediately begins to retry the connection. The default retry duration is 720 minutes. You can customize the retry time to a value from 10 to 1440 minutes. We recommend that you set the duration to more than 30 minutes. If DTS reconnects to the source and destination databases within the specified duration, the migration task automatically resumes. Otherwise, the task fails.

      Note
      • For multiple DTS instances that share the same source or destination, the network retry time is determined by the setting of the last created task.

      • Because you are charged for the task during the connection retry period, we recommend that you customize the retry time based on your business needs, or release the DTS instance as soon as possible after the source and destination database instances are released.

      Retry Time for Other Issues

      After the migration task starts, if a non-connectivity issue, such as a DDL or DML execution exception, occurs in the source or destination database, DTS reports an error and immediately begins to retry the operation. The default retry duration is 10 minutes. You can customize the retry time to a value from 1 to 1440 minutes. We recommend that you set the duration to more than 10 minutes. If the related operations succeed within the specified retry duration, the migration task automatically resumes. Otherwise, the task fails.

      Important

      The value of Retry Time for Other Issues must be less than the value of Retry Time for Failed Connections.
